  • Patent number: 5799197
    Abstract: Data read out from a disk is once written in a memory, and data is read out from memory at a rate lower than the writing rate. In a power saving mode, when data in the memory reaches full capacity, the power to a pickup, an RF amplifier, a decoder/signal processing circuit, a servo circuit, and a driver circuit for driving a spindle motor and a sending motor is turned off, thereby temporarily stopping data reading from the disk. Reading from the disk and writing into the memory resumes when power is restored before the memory is completely read out.

  • Patent number: 5790511
    Abstract: An optical pickup unit is formed such that a portion on an upstream side of the air flow has a streamline shape or similar shape to the streamline shape so as to keep the air flow generated with high speed rotations of a disc-shaped recording medium away from a vicinity of an objective lens. According to this arrangement, dust contained in the air flow can be prevented from adhering to the surface of the objective lens. Moreover, the dust will not enter inside the optical pickup unit through a small clearance between a lens holder of the objective lens and a cover for the optical pickup unit.

  • Patent number: 5446911
    Abstract: A source program is stored for every line of the source program in a source program memory. Jump commands in the language used in the program are previously stored in a jump command memory for storing jump commands used in the program. The contents of the source program memory are compared with the contents of the jump command memory, the kinds of each commands in the source program are identified, and first and second identification data are produced. The first identification data which are set for each command identifies the kind of each command, and identifies that the execution contents of commands adjacent to each other along the sequence of commands are continuous. The second identification data are set for each jump command and each command to which processing is to be jumped. The first and second identification data are stored in the identification data memory. The process flow of the source program is analyzed based on the contents of the identification data memory in an analyzer.

  • Patent number: 5249065
    Abstract: The invention relates to a still picture recording apparatus for selecting and recording a desired screen of analog video signal as a still picture. The apparatus of the invention includes a still picture memory for storing digital signals for at least one screen, a delay memory for delaying a screen stored in the still picture memory by a time of a portion of one or plural screens, a change detecting circuit for detecting change in the screen by comparing the stored contents of the still picture memory and the delay memory and for detecting a large change in the screen, and a recording apparatus for recording the stored content of the still picture memory onto a recording medium, such as magnetic tape, when the screen is changed by a large amount, in response to the output of the screen change detecting circuit.

  • Patent number: 4869566
    Abstract: A connector with a plug having a protruding piece and a jack for accepting it can transmit not only electrical signals but also light signals between devices connected thereby. Optical fibers for transmitting light signals therethrough are placed longitudinally inside the protruding piece of the plug and the jack includes not only electrodes for transmitting electrical signals but also a light emitting element to transmit light signals into the plug through the optical fibers or a light receiving element for receiving light signals transmitted through the optical fibers.

  • Patent number: 4719521
    Abstract: A PCM recording and reproducing apparatus record digital signals obtained by sampling and quantizing analog signals on a recording medium after adding control words, synchronizing signals, etc. to the digital signals. The PCM recording and reproducing apparatus includes means for setting sampling frequencies, means for controlling the speed of recording the signals on said recording medium so as to comply with the set sampling frequency, means for generating sampling frequency indicating codes, and means for adding the sampling frequency indicating codes to the digital signals. Accordingly, sound signals can be recorded and reproduced at various sampling frequencies by the recording and reproducing apparatus of the present invention.

  • Patent number: 4623941
    Abstract: A PCM type record-playback system converts an analog primary signal into a digital signal by sampling and quantizing it and concurrently records it on a magnetic tape with a secondary signal for showing the tape position. The primary and secondary signals are recorded on the same track in a time-divided manner so that recording can be effected with a small number of magnetic heads and the tracks on the magnetic tape can be effectively utilized.

  • Patent number: 4384284
    Abstract: An audio visual system includes an audio cassette tape player, a central processor unit, a TV screen for displaying a desired pattern in accordance with a data derived from the audio cassette tape player, and a speaker system for providing audio announcement in accordance with information derived from the audio cassette tape player. The audio visual system displays a problem and five typical answers thereto. The student introduces his answer through a keyboard unit. When, for example, an answer key 3 is actuated, the audio visual system drives the audio cassette tape player to locate a commentary suited for response to the actuation of the answer key 3 whereby the commentary associated with answer key 3 is displayed and announced.

  • Patent number: 4226425
    Abstract: A nonrecorded section detection sensor is mounted on a sensor arm which is rotatable around a shaft, to which a drive mechanism is connected to scan the nonrecorded section detection sensor above a disc. A slit plate is fixed to the shaft to detect the rotation of the shaft, whereby the address of a nonrecorded section provided between two adjacent tracks recorded on the disc is detected. Another slit plate is fixed to a tonearm drive shaft to detect a current address of a pickup cartridge mounted on a tonearm. A control circuit functions to locate the pickup cartridge at a beginning position of a selected track through the use of information related to the addresses of the nonrecorded section and the pickup cartridge.
